Is there a way to close a child company? I bought another promotion out and kept them as a developmental territory but i no longer want them

 

Go to relationships, highlight your child company's name and hit end relationship. You'll need to call up or release everyone in a developmental contract first. The company will still be around but won't be associated with you anymore.

 

I was clicking too fast and accidentally cancelled my big event. I'm on the next day. Is there a way I can go back and undo that?

 

Hit load game, highlight the save in question then hit game recovery.

Yes I know that, but why 20.000 people are supposed to come, and only 4.000 are here ?

 

You should have a double check. It may be that you're looking at the line about the *last time* that you put on a show in that region.

 

An example is that it usually states the last time you were in the Great Lakes you drew 20,000. In the next line it would say you are expected to draw 5,000 for tonight's show (4,135 if figurehead not used).
